Book excerpt: Memory Evolutive Systems; Hierarchy, Emergence, Cognition provides comprehensive and comprehensible coverage of Memory Evolutive Systems (MEM). Written by the developers of the MEM, the book proposes a mathematical model for autonomous evolutionary systems based on the Category Theory of mathematics. It describes a framework to study and possibly simulate the structure of living systems and their dynamic behavior. This book contributes to understanding the multidisciplinary interfaces between mathematics, cognition, consciousness, biology and the study of complexity. It is organized into three parts. Part A deals with hierarchy and emergence and covers such topics as net of interactions and categories; the binding problem; and complexifications and emergence. Part B is about MEM while Part C discusses MEM applications to cognition and consciousness. The book explores the characteristics of a complex evolutionary system, its differences from inanimate physical systems, and its functioning and evolution in time, from its birth to its death. This book is an ideal reference for researchers, teachers and students in pure mathematics, computer science, cognitive science, study of complexity and systems theory, Category Theory, biological systems theory, and consciousness theory. Book excerpt: Brain Inspired Cognitive Systems 2008 (June 24-27, 2008; São Luís, Brazil) brought together leading scientists and engineers who use analytic, syntactic and computational methods both to understand the prodigious processing properties of biological systems and, specifically, of the brain, and to exploit such knowledge to advance computational methods towards ever higher levels of cognitive competence. This book includes the papers presented at four major symposia: Part I - Cognitive Neuroscience Part II - Biologically Inspired Systems Part III - Neural Computation Part IV - Models of Consciousness.

Book excerpt: Often people have wondered why there is no introductory text on category theory aimed at philosophers working in related areas. The answer is simple: what makes categories interesting and significant is their specific use for specific purposes. These uses and purposes, however, vary over many areas, both "pure", e.g., mathematical, foundational and logical, and "applied", e.g., applied to physics, biology and the nature and structure of mathematical models. Borrowing from the title of Saunders Mac Lane's seminal work "Categories for the Working Mathematician", this book aims to bring the concepts of category theory to philosophers working in areas ranging from mathematics to proof theory to computer science to ontology, from to physics to biology to cognition, from mathematical modeling to the structure of scientific theories to the structure of the world. Moreover, it aims to do this in a way that is accessible to non-specialists. Each chapter is written by either a category-theorist or a philosopher working in one of the represented areas, and in a way that builds on the concepts that are already familiar to philosophers working in these areas.

Book excerpt: This book is useful to engineers, researchers, entrepreneurs, and students in different branches of production, engineering, and systems sciences. The polytopic roadmaps are the guidelines inspired by the development stages of cognitive-intelligent systems, and expected to become powerful instruments releasing an abundance of new capabilities and structures for complex engineering systems implementation. The 4D approach developed in previous monographs and correlated with industry 4.0and Fourth Industrial Revolution is continued here toward higher dimensions approaches correlated with polytopic operations, equipment, technologies, industries, and societies. Methodology emphasizes the role of doubling, iteration, dimensionality, and cyclicality around the center, of periodic tables and of conservative and exploratory strategies. Partitions, permutations, classifications, and complexification, as polytopic chemistry, are the elementary operations analyzed. Multi-scale transfer, cyclic operations, conveyors, and assembly lines are the practical examples of operations and equipment. Polytopic flow sheets, online analytical processing, polytopic engineering designs, and reality-inspired engineering are presented. Innovative concepts such as Industry 5.0, polytopic industry, Society 5.0, polytopic society, cyber physical social systems, industrial Internet, and digital twins have been discussed. The general polytopic roadmaps, (GPTR), are proposed as universal guidelines and as common methodologies to synthesize the systemic thinking and capabilities for growing complexity projects implementation.
